How they compare
Greece currently reports 46 1000 USD against 37 1000 USD in Italy, a difference of 9 1000 USD.
That makes Greece's figure about 1.2 times Italy's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 5 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Italy ahead.
Greece ranks 16th and Italy ranks 18th of 34 countries.
Greece has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
